Bipolar disorder is one of the most common and potentially devastating psychiatric illnesses.

This textbook provides clinicians with a comprehensive overview of rational and research-informed contemporary clinical practice in the assessment and medical management of patients with bipolar disorder.

There has been a resurgence of interest in the pharmacological treatment of bipolar disorders.

In "Bipolar Disorders", clinicians who are faced with making choices from a variety of treatments are instructed how to mould their practice around the long-term symptomatic and functional needs of their patients.

With a focus on pharmacotherapy, the foundation of symptomatic treatment, "Bipolar Disorders" provides an up-to-date analysis of the data regarding efficacy and safety of medication along with practical guidelines with which treatment choices can be made.
